Description

This specimen, identified as a native grape, features lush, heart-shaped green foliage on slender, vining stems. While not yet trained, its vigorous growth habit and leaf structure present a unique challenge and opportunity for bonsai cultivation, potentially developing into an informal-upright or cascade style.
